Javascript: Move caret to last character

The following function will work in all major browsers, for both textareas and text inputs: function moveCaretToEnd(el) { if (typeof el.selectionStart == “number”) { el.selectionStart = el.selectionEnd = el.value.length; } else if (typeof el.createTextRange != “undefined”) { el.focus(); var range = el.createTextRange(); range.collapse(false); range.select(); } } However, you really shouldn’t do this whenever the user … Read more